If you have a knack for customer service work or past experience with this work, you may be able to do customer service working from home. There are many customer service jobs available for someone that wants to work from home. Research opportunities online and in newspapers, so that you can find the job that best suits you. Remember to check to make sure that the business opportunity is legitimate and not a scam. Customer service jobs will require some tools for you to do the job. The tools will include a working computer with internet services and a telephone line that has long distance. Some customer service jobs will be strictly incoming calls like a technical support company or a catalogue company. While other customer service jobs will require you to take incoming calls and also make outgoing calls.

When working a customer service job you will have to have the skills needed to work with customers over the phone or online. You also have to be able to work with customers that may be difficult. You have to have the skills to communicate effectively with others and sell the product, if there is a product involved. Some companies do their customer service through the internet where you may chat with clients through a chat room or via e-mail, as well.
